Ability to overwrite existing files only of the source file is newer Supports resume which means the file transfer process can be paused and continued Support IPv6 which is the latest version of internet protocol Transfer files using FTP and encrypted FTP such as FTPS (server and client) and SFTP. Configurable transfer speed limits to limit the speed transferring the files, which helps reducing error of transferring When the file doesn't have the same information (name not match, or size not match) it will highlight that file in colour. Directory comparison for comparing local files and server files in the same directory. Bookmarks for easy access to most frequent use Site Manager to manage server lists and transfer queue for ordering file transfer tasks Tabbed user interface for multitasking, to allow browsing more than one server or even transfer files simultaneously between multiple servers. Logging events to file for debugging, saved at custom location. Keep-alive, if the connection has been idle for the long time it will check by sending keep-alive command. Since the project's participation in SourceForge's program to create revenue by adware, several reviewers started warning about downloading FileZilla and discouraged users from using it. In January 2012, CNET gave FileZilla their highest rating of "spectacular"—five out of five stars. FileZilla is available in the repositories of many Linux distributions, including Debian, Ubuntu, Trisquel and Parabola GNU/Linux-libre. As of 2016, FileZilla displays ads (called sponsored updates) when starting the application. The FileZilla webpage offers additional download options without adware installs, but the link to the adware download appears as the primary link, highlighted and marked as "recommended". Also, users reported adware programs to download and install more unwanted software, some causing alerts by security suites, for being malware. Some of the adware was reported to resist removal or restoration of previous settings, or were said to reinstall after a supposed removal. Among the reported effects are: web browser being hijacked, with content, start page and search engines being forcibly changed, popup windows, privacy or spying issues, sudden shutdown and restart events possibly leading to loss of current work.
